Columbus Energy  (WAR:CLC) 3-1 Month Momentum % Explanation

Momentum investing is a trading strategy in which investors buy securities that are rising and sell before the prices start to go back down. The 3-1 Month Momentum % measures the total return to a stock over the past three months, but ignores the previous month.

The reason why the most recent month’s return dropped related to the short-term reversal effect associated with momentum. There is an academic finding that short-term momentum actually has a reversal effect, whereby the previous winners (measured over the past months) do poorly the next month, while the previous losers do well the next month. In order to eliminate the short-term reversal effect, the previous month return was not included in this calculation.

Columbus Energy  (WAR:CLC) 3-1 Month Momentum % Calculation

3-1 Month Momentum % is calculated as following:

3-1 Month Momentum %=( Price 1-month ago / Price 3-month ago - 1 ) * 100 %

Columbus Energy Business Description

Other Exchanges 0Q8:Germany0Q8:Germany
Address ul. Forge Kollatajowskiej 13, Krakow, POL, 40-005
Columbus Energy SA is a Poland based company involved in providing energy efficiency services. Its products include photovoltaic systems, that convert solar radiation into electricity.
